Output e21efe164d7868285cad6627d775241f57f250b31125f9f7d5bf2b34a2a7601b:4
- value
- 403789
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8a109639ccb915690015292d0ea71cd672a9e4a
- address
- bc1qazssjcuuewg4dyqp22fdp6n3e4nj48j2qgukt0
- transaction
- e21efe164d7868285cad6627d775241f57f250b31125f9f7d5bf2b34a2a7601b